Buyers benefit from a greater selection and lower prices.
September 26th, 2007 9:54 AM
Due to increasing foreclosure activity, tighter lending guidelines and soft demand, buyers have more to choose from at lower prices. Most lenders will realistically set the prices for their REO inventory at or below what the most recent comparable homes have sold for within the immediate area.
